Proceeding contribution from Vincent Cable (Liberal Democrat) in the House of Commons on Monday, 19 June 2006. It occurred during Ministerial statement on European Council.
European Council
Following the Prime Minister’s announcement that the Union is entering into what I think he called strategic negotiations with Russia and other energy suppliers over the long-term security of supply, would it not be reasonable for those countries to ask in return for security of demand, and how would a market economy such as ours provide such security?
